use std::path::Path;
use crate::crypto::Signer as _;
use crate::git;
use crate::identity::Id;
use crate::storage::git::Storage;
use crate::storage::WriteStorage;
use crate::test::arbitrary;
use crate::test::crypto::MockSigner;
pub fn storage<P: AsRef<Path>>(path: P) -> Storage {
let path = path.as_ref();
let proj_ids = arbitrary::set::<Id>(3..=3);
let signers = arbitrary::set::<MockSigner>(3..=3);
let storage = Storage::open(path).unwrap();
crate::test::logger::init(log::Level::Debug);
for signer in signers {
let remote = signer.public_key();
log::debug!("signer {}...", remote);
for proj in proj_ids.iter() {
let repo = storage.repository(proj).unwrap();
let raw = &repo.backend;
let sig = git2::Signature::now(&remote.to_string(), "anonymous@radicle.xyz").unwrap();
let head = git::initial_commit(raw, &sig).unwrap();
log::debug!("{}: creating {}...", remote, proj);
raw.reference(
&format!("refs/remotes/{remote}/heads/radicle/id"),
head.id(),
false,
"test",
)
.unwrap();
let head = git::commit(raw, &head, "Second commit", &remote.to_string()).unwrap();
raw.reference(
&format!("refs/remotes/{remote}/heads/master"),
head.id(),
false,
"test",
)
.unwrap();
let head = git::commit(raw, &head, "Third commit", &remote.to_string()).unwrap();
raw.reference(
&format!("refs/remotes/{remote}/heads/patch/3"),
head.id(),
false,
"test",
)
.unwrap();
storage.sign_refs(&repo, &signer).unwrap();
}
}
storage
}
/// Creates a regular repository at the given path with a couple of commits.
pub fn repository<P: AsRef<Path>>(path: P) -> git2::Repository {
let repo = git2::Repository::init(path).unwrap();
{
let sig = git2::Signature::now("anonymous", "anonymous@radicle.xyz").unwrap();
let head = git::initial_commit(&repo, &sig).unwrap();
let head = git::commit(&repo, &head, "Second commit", "anonymous").unwrap();
let _branch = repo.branch("master", &head, false).unwrap();
}
repo
}
